Garage Water Damage Cleanup v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water spill (<1 gallon) | Yes | No | You can likely clean it up yourself with a wet vacuum and some towels. |
| Visible water damage or leaks | No | Yes | A professional assessment is needed to find out the extent of the damage and prevent further issues. |
| Mold or mildew growth | No | Yes | A professional is needed to remove the mold or mildew and prevent future growth. |
| Electrical issues or short circuits | No | Yes | A professional assessment is needed to ensure your garage is safe and secure. |
| Warped or buckled flooring | No | Yes | A professional is needed to assess and repair or replace the affected areas. |
| Peeling paint or wallpaper | No | Yes | A professional is needed to identify the source of the problem and provide a solution to prevent further damage. |

Garage Water Damage Cleanup Cost in Magna, UT
The cost of garage water damage cleanup in Magna, UT can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. These estimates are based on average prices and may vary depending on your specific situation. We’ll provide a free estimate to ensure you get the best value for your money.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age |
| Drying and d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ment used |
| Sanitizing and disinfecting | $500 – $2,000 | Type of equipment used, extent of damage |
| Restoration and reconstruction | $2,000 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, type of materials needed |
| Emergency response | $100 – $500 | Time of day, severity of damage |
